Chakundi Population - Nadia, West Bengal
Chakundi is a medium size village located in Kaliganj Block of Nadia district, West Bengal with total 287 families residing. The Chakundi village has population of 1186 of which 614 are males while 572 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Chakundi village population of children with age 0-6 is 116 which makes up 9.78 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chakundi village is 932 which is lower than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Chakundi as per census is 758, lower than West Bengal average of 956.
Chakundi village has lower liter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Chakundi village was 67.29 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Chakundi Male literacy stands at 74.45 % while female literacy rate was 59.77 %.

Chakundi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 287 | - | - |
Population | 1,186 | 614 | 572 |
Child (0-6) | 116 | 66 | 50 |
Schedule Caste | 869 | 453 | 416 |
Schedule Tribe | 3 | 0 | 3 |
Literacy | 67.29 % | 74.45 % | 59.77 % |
Total Workers | 374 | 327 | 47 |
Main Worker | 318 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 56 | 26 | 30 |
